Considerations for Real Projects
While I Will Not Comply is a solid design, there are a few things to keep in mind before using it in a finished product. For instance, the design may not perform well on very thin or stretchy fabrics. The letters are relatively large, so they might distort slightly on curved surfaces like caps or hats. Also, because the design is text-based, it relies heavily on thread contrast and stitch density to maintain clarity.Design Notes for Embroidery Professionals

For crafters and small business owners, I Will Not Comply offers a strong foundation for creating personalized gifts or custom apparel. However, it’s important to consider how the design will look after stitching. Dense areas of text may require higher stitch density settings, which can increase the time and effort needed to complete the project.Final Thoughts
